Coastguard Helicopter Airlifts Woman After Allergic Reaction Causes Cliff Fall in West Wight
Major Rescue Operation in Compton Bay
A dramatic rescue unfolded in West Wight on Thursday evening after a woman suffered a severe allergic reaction and plunged down the cliffs at Compton Bay. Emergency services swung into action just before 7pm, mobilising two Coastguard Rescue Teams from Ventnor and Needles.
Helicopter and Fire Crews Join The Effort
The Coastguard Helicopter was scrambled to the scene to airlift the woman to hospital. The Isle of Wight Fire and Rescue Service also deployed a Co-responder alongside ambulance crews to provide urgent medical support at the cliff base.
Victim Now Stable After Emergency Treatment
Following treatment by hospital doctors, the woman is reported to be stable and making a steady recovery. The swift response from multiple emergency teams was praised for saving her life.
